With songs described as 'music for the soul' (Maverick Magazine), British singer-songwriter Emily Maguire has released six albums and toured Europe extensively with American legends Don McLean, Dr Hook and Eric Bibb.

A classically trained multi-instrumentalist and composer, Emily is a contemporary folk artist whose songs have been used by Greenpeace and Hollywood, has performed gigs in prisons and psychiatric hospitals, and whose hauntingly beautiful voice has been heard in concert halls across the UK and Ireland.

With a remarkable, inspiring story to tell and songs 'bathed in raw, emotional power' (Guitarist Magazine), Emily has been featured many times in playlists and interviews on BBC national radio. Her live show, featuring renowned local violinist Sarah King, cellist Louise King and bass player Christian Dunham, is an intensely melodic and moving experience not to be missed.
